Visualizzazione dei risultati da 1 a 10 su 11

Hybrid View

  1. #1
    Quote Originariamente inviata da spode Visualizza il messaggio
    o.o grazie! Come fa la CPU a discernere i casi da te elencati?
    La CPU non ne sa nulla, glielo dice il codice cosa deve fare; a seconda del tipo su cui effettuare l'operazione c'è un opcode diverso. Ad esempio, su x86 ci sono un tot di ADD/SUB diversi per gli interi (a seconda delle dimensioni e dell'origine degli operandi), MUL/IMUL e DIV/IDIV a seconda se si tratta di interi con o senza segno e un set di istruzioni completamente separato (x87 o i vari SSE) per i numeri in virgola mobile.
    I tipi vengono esplicitamente associati alle variabili solo nei linguaggi interpretati e/o a tipizzazione dinamica, ovvero quando è necessario sapere a runtime qual è il tipo della variabile.
    Ultima modifica di MItaly; 29-10-2013 a 22:28
    Amaro C++, il gusto pieno dell'undefined behavior.

  2. #2
    Utente di HTML.it L'avatar di kuarl
    Registrato dal
    Oct 2001
    Messaggi
    1,093
    Quote Originariamente inviata da MItaly Visualizza il messaggio
    I tipi vengono esplicitamente associati alle variabili solo nei linguaggi interpretati e/o a tipizzazione dinamica, ovvero quando è necessario sapere a runtime qual è il tipo della variabile.
    uhmm... non ho capito



    aspetta aspetta.... ci sono
    Ultima modifica di kuarl; 31-10-2013 a 19:39 Motivo: eureka!

Tag per questa discussione

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.